Diplomats generally command high salaries and you can expect to earn a 6-figure salary, upwards of $170,000 per annum. There are usually a lot of perks for diplomats stationed abroad, including personal drivers, accommodation, living allowances, education costs for your kids, and more.

This is highly specialised field, so there are no clear employment figures for this occupation. Australian Diplomats are employed by the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(DFAT).

Diplomats have post-graduate qualifications plus outstanding communication and interpersonal skills. They are usually multilingual and fluent in at least one language other than English. There is no direct career pathway for diplomats, so choose degrees and graduate studies that will be useful across countries and culture: laws, political science, international relations, economics, commerce etc. You may also benefit from supporting qualifications in public relations, marketing, foreign languages, and philosophy. Once you have your degrees, look at the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ade (DFAT) graduate program.

If you are considering a career as a diplomat, exploring the various Diplomat courses in Victoria is an excellent starting point. Victoria offers a range of advanced courses tailored for experienced learners, including programs such as the Bachelor of Arts (Politics) and the Master of Public Policy. These courses are structured to provide you with the critical thinking and policy analysis skills necessary for a successful diplomatic career, preparing you to address complex international issues.

Several renowned institutions in Victoria are committed to delivering quality education in diplomacy and international relations. Notable providers include Monash University, known for its comprehensive Bachelor of Arts (Honours) in International Relations, and RMIT University, which specialises in the Master of Public Policy. Additionally, The University of Melbourne offers the highly regarded Bachelor of Arts (Politics and International Studies), equipping students with the skills needed for various diplomatic roles.

Students can also consider other prestigious options such as Bachelor of International Studies from Deakin University or the Master of International Relations from La Trobe University.
